Tolichowki Flyover, Hyderabad: Directions, Connectivity, Nearby Areas

Few localities in Hyderabad capture the city’s particular talent for layering the traditional alongside the contemporary as effectively as Tolichowki. Sitting at the junction between the old city’s cultural gravitational pull and the western technology corridor’s commercial magnetism, Tolichowki has evolved into one of South Hyderabad’s most commercially active and residentially dense localities — a place where film production offices, budget hotels, dense apartment blocks, local mosques, and the daily commercial energy of a working-class market zone coexist with the extraordinary proximity to HITEC City’s technology towers just a few kilometres to the north. The Tolichowki Flyover spans the junction that anchors this locality’s identity, providing the elevated through-passage along the Mehdipatnam-HITEC City corridor that keeps one of Hyderabad’s busiest daily commute routes from becoming entirely unmanageable.

The flyover’s importance is particularly acute during the twin peak hours when the enormous IT workforce of HITEC City and Gachibowli moves in one direction and the commercial and institutional traffic of the old city and Mehdipatnam moves in the other. For Tolichowki’s large residential population of working professionals, film industry workers, hospitality staff, and the mixed community that gives this locality its distinctive energy, the flyover is daily infrastructure in the most immediate sense — the structure that determines whether the morning commute begins within a reasonable time or slides into the kind of delay that defines the pre-flyover road experience at this junction.

Directions to Tolichowki Flyover


From HITEC City: Travel southward from HITEC City via the HITEC City-Tolichowki Road heading toward the southern residential belt. Continue through Madhapur and approach Tolichowki approximately 6 to 8 kilometres from HITEC City’s main gate. Travel time is approximately 20 to 30 minutes, though this stretch’s peak-hour congestion can extend journeys considerably beyond this baseline estimate.

From Mehdipatnam: Travel westward from Mehdipatnam Bus Station along the Mehdipatnam Road heading toward Tolichowki. The flyover is approximately 2 to 3 kilometres from Mehdipatnam with a travel time of 10 to 15 minutes — one of the most direct and heavily used approaches to the junction from the eastern residential direction.

From Gachibowli: Travel southeastward from Gachibowli via the Gachibowli-Tolichowki connector heading toward the Shaikpet zone. Approach Tolichowki from the northwestern direction approximately 8 to 10 kilometres from Gachibowli’s main junction with a travel time of 20 to 35 minutes.

From Hyderabad Airport via ORR: Travel northward from the airport via the Outer Ring Road heading toward the city. Exit toward Narsingi and continue northward toward the Tolichowki zone. Total distance from Rajiv Gandhi International Airport is approximately 35 to 40 kilometres with a travel time of 45 to 65 minutes.

From Charminar / Old City: Travel northwestward from Charminar along the old city arterials toward Mehdipatnam. Continue westward from Mehdipatnam toward Tolichowki. Total distance is approximately 12 to 14 kilometres with a travel time of 30 to 50 minutes through the characteristically dense old city road network.

Metro and Public Transport Connectivity

Tolichowki Metro Station on the Hyderabad Metro Blue Line sits directly at this junction, making the flyover area one of the better metro-served nodes in south-central Hyderabad. The Blue Line connects Tolichowki westward toward Lingampally and Raidurgam, and eastward through Ameerpet, Begumpet, Secunderabad, and Nagole — covering the full east-west span of the city in a single corridor. The metro’s presence has been particularly valuable for IT professionals commuting from Tolichowki’s affordable residential belt toward HITEC City, reducing private vehicle dependence meaningfully in this direction. TSRTC buses operate through the Tolichowki junction connecting to Mehdipatnam Bus Station, Rethibowli, and the broader Hyderabad bus network. Auto-rickshaws serve the dense intra-locality movement needs throughout the day, and app-based cabs are well-supplied given the professional population of the surrounding residential zones.

Road Connectivity

  • Mehdipatnam Road connects eastward toward Mehdipatnam’s commercial and transit hub.
  • HITEC City Road extends northwestward toward the technology corridor via Madhapur and Kondapur.
  • Rethibowli Road connects eastward toward the Rethibowli wholesale market zone.
  • Shaikpet Road extends southward toward the Shaikpet residential zone adjacent to the historic Shaikpet Fort.

Nearby Areas and Neighbourhoods

Mehdipatnam: Directly east of the flyover, Mehdipatnam is one of south-central Hyderabad’s most commercially active localities, housing a major bus terminal, dense retail markets, budget accommodation, and the working-class commercial energy that has defined this locality for decades.

Shaikpet: A historically significant locality south of Tolichowki, Shaikpet is home to the ruins of the medieval Shaikpet Fort and has developed into a mixed residential and commercial zone popular among families seeking affordable housing within reasonable reach of the HITEC City employment corridor.

Rethibowli: The wholesale vegetable and produce market east of the flyover generates early morning commercial traffic that gives the Tolichowki junction its distinctively early peak pattern, with market-related vehicles arriving and departing from 4 AM onward.

Nanakramguda: An emerging financial and technology hub southwest of Tolichowki along the Gachibowli corridor, Nanakramguda has attracted major financial services companies and IT offices that contribute to the professional commuter traffic flowing through the Tolichowki junction daily.

Manikonda: A rapidly developing residential locality south of the flyover, Manikonda offers mid-segment apartment housing at competitive prices for IT professionals working in the HITEC City and Gachibowli corridor who prefer southern residential addresses.
